Ronin Tactical's New Site
Friday, August 12, 2016
American Defense Delta HD 30mm Scope Mount 1.5" Center Height - 20 MOA
American Defense
Delta HD
30mm Scope Mount
1.5" Center Height
20 MOA
Read more here:
https://www.americandefensemanufacturing.com/view/product/867/
Newer Post
Older Post
Home
View mobile version